Today i’m making a snack for my little boys, and for me also of course. A famous snack in the States called
Sloppy Joe’s.

A “Sloppy Joe” is a sandwich with a kind of Bolognese sauce on it. Sloppy Joe’s were made the first time in 1930 in Sioux City by a cook named Joe, who added loose meat to his sandwiches. It really got famous in the Sloppy Joe’s bar in Key West, the hangout of Ernest Hemmingway.

So we start with chopping our ingredients. 1 medium size onion.

826B525E-7E7C-4020-968C-9D88B61E6769.jpeg

2 cloves of garlic,

15251312-E059-4B38-B58F-1C108E33109D.jpeg

1 green bell pepper,

6EA8C1DE-AEEE-4FB1-886C-3BA5F2EA811F.jpeg

i also add a red big sweet pepper. I know in the original recipe there is only green pepper but i like some colour and i’m in Spain(the big red peppers are delicious here) so...

ACEFEDEB-3089-416F-A2E9-9B7F3794A136.jpeg

C427831A-0EF1-497B-9C10-A37B4DB4DB8E.jpeg

Then 1 kilo of ground beef.

9760EF15-B4BB-4188-BB46-999F4185EA84.jpeg

So i start with frying my onions, garlic and peppers.

0AE80034-A833-408A-96DF-8EF23C04BBA8.jpeg

41469D20-CB37-4312-8288-C69A726DBB1C.jpeg

Then i add my beef,

C3780BDC-FDE7-4BAA-8D95-DFA4D2F74B59.jpeg

and then the most important ingredient. Ketchup!

D622C45E-4E60-4778-ABE8-C2F2C51C119A.jpeg

So when baking your beef, add ketchup and don’t be to modest. Don’t forget salt and pepper of course.👌

6F3938A5-1FE3-45EB-A852-8A2A16A736EF.jpeg

Then some mustard and Worchester sauce(not too much).

B9EFD497-B717-4D4A-A6DC-4770A5342BF7.jpeg

58A218EB-20B1-4F4C-9B5A-3E7202627B2E.jpeg

Add a cup of water and let it simmer for half an hour.

I also add a little yeast extract for extra flavour and some tomato pasata because i don’t like it too sweet. Also not in the original recipe...

DA831362-92E8-409F-ABB5-C4F43A4CF70F.jpeg

FAB65FFE-DA30-40DB-A1D0-809BE0F37CF2.jpeg

A little brown sugar, not too much!

7ACBB00A-D3F4-49DC-BC29-E4844009F1F5.jpeg

I like it spicy so i add some spicy guindillas or pepperoni peppers.

D2A9865C-D40F-4A63-86F9-4A4EDECCAF8F.jpeg

5C12E15A-F2B3-4199-9EE5-64D74A026305.jpeg

Then let it simmer for 10 minutes more until most of the water is gone and it’s getting solid.

Then buns in the oven...

2316A76B-7FB2-4067-98AD-8B663D32F0FA.jpeg

Put your sloppy Joe sauce on them,

2BD62396-8FF2-46DA-8278-EF0ECD54F34E.jpeg

I add some crunchy onions and jalapeño to get it some bite and spice.
Also add some potatoe chips, my boys especially love that. Chips for dinner.😂

FD8AAE89-32A2-42A9-A5C5-A8D65332E9B5.jpeg

And just enjoy your Sloppy friend!
